Step 5. Now, using your paintbrush (or a dotting tool if you prefer) create the 'sparks' coming from the middle of the firework. I used Rimmels Lasting Finish in Double Decker Red, but you can use any colour you think will match what colours you have already painted on.
Create the dots in the middle of the firework, as well as going outwards. |
Step 6. Now it's time for the glitter!
Using a glittery Nail Art Pen, or just a regular glitter nail polish, paint from the middle of the firework, going out. This will add lots of sparkle to your firework, making it stand out more. I painted strokes going out from the middle but tried not to cover all of the firework, so you could still see the colours. |
